The Random Wrestling Review is an explicit mess of in-depth wrestling analysis and puerile humour which focuses on a single event from any point in history and breaks it down crudely and with no apologies. The podcast is currently trawling through the history of Wrestlemania, covering each event one-by-one, taking in the good, the bad, the ugly and the nonsense. Previously, we featured shows stretching from 1984 through to 2021 from a variety of promotions including WWE, WCW, AEW, ECW, NWA, NXT and AWA, so there is bound to be something you like when you join Ben, Tom, Matt and Stephen as they seek out the perfect wrestling show. Listeners beware, this show is not suitable for young ears!

It's time for Stephen Coriander to talk about one of his favourites on the 2nd episode of The Heroes. His pick is 'Macho Man' Randy Savage and here we go over the peak of his career from Wrestlemania 3, the Mega Powers, Wrestlemania 5, his heel turn, the Dusty Rhodes feud, the career match with The Ultimate Warrior and his big 1992, back as a babyface and Champion again.
